Saida is a district of the Saxon community Kreischa in the district of Saxon Switzerland-Eastern Ore Mountains .
geography
Saida is located south of the state capital Dresden , west of the city of Dohna and east of Kreischa.

history
Saida was first mentioned in a document in 1350. In 1378 the place belonged to the Dresden Castrum, from 1547 to the Dresden office . After that, the place belonged to the Dippoldiswalde court office from 1856 to 1875 , then to the office of the same name . On April 1, 1939, Saida was incorporated into Gombsen, later Wittgensdorf was added. In 1952 Saida became part of the Freital district (later the district ). On January 1, 1974, Gombsen was incorporated into Kreischa. In the course of the district reform in Saxony in 1994 , Kreischa and its districts became part of the newly formed Weisseritz district from the districts of Freital and Dippoldiswalde . This was August 1, 2008 with the District Saxon Switzerland for District Saxon Switzerland-Osterzgebirge combined.
Development of the population
year | population |
---|---|
1547 | 6 possessed man |
1764 | 4 possessed men, 9 cottagers |
1834 | 99 |
1871 | 85 |
1890 | 64 |
1910 | 83 |
1925 | 88 |
